Output 51a679700ef8c04d753590add01ca2d21ed003bb0121587e8bd27b9ce29b3be7:14

value
25016471
script pubkey
OP_0 OP_PUSHBYTES_32 5fc488826404e39ef203fd783d05e2f0190e4ddf1fc8c826eae648eef67f22f8
address
bc1qtlzg3qnyqn3eausrl4ur6p0z7qvsunwlrlyvsfh2ueywaanlytuquncalf
transaction
51a679700ef8c04d753590add01ca2d21ed003bb0121587e8bd27b9ce29b3be7
spent
true